Bennet reimer - Bennett Reimer's A Philosophy of Music Education asserts that the nature and value of music education are determined primarily by the nature and value of music. Originally published in 1970 (with the third edition originally published in 2003), this text relates findings in the field of aesthetics to their implications for the practice of music ...

Beattie Professor of Music Education Emeritus at Northwestern University, where he was chair of the Music Education Department and founder and director of the Center for the Study of Education and the Musical Experience, a research group of Ph.D. students and faculty. He said music is sound organized to be expressive, a complex and unique function of the mind, self-knowledge, sensitivity to symbolic languageBennett Reimer - ACT Journal - MayDay Group EN English Deutsch Français Español Português Italiano Român Nederlands Latina Dansk Svenska Norsk Magyar Bahasa Indonesia Türkçe Suomi Latvian Lithuanian český русский български العربية UnknownThe work of Bennet Reimer is one the most notable in the philosophy of music education. For him, aesthetic education and listening are inherent components of music education. Learn vocabulary, terms, and more with flashcards, games, and other study tools.Bennet Reimer, in contrast to Elliot, uses the aesthetic concept of music largely to support his philosophy. Reimer states that "Aesthetic education in music attempts to enhance learnings related to the following propositions: 1. Musical sounds create and share meanings available only from such sounds. 2.
